Nanoarchitectonics has been paid much attention as an emerging concept to architect functional materials from molecular and nanounits through the combination of nanotechnology-oriented strategies and supramolecular-chemistry-like methodologies. This perspective article aims to figure out important keys for materials nanoarchitectonics. In the initial part, recent trends in materials nanoarchitectonics upon supramolecular self-assembly are overviewed. The overview processes extract several key words including dynamic natures, dimensional controls, and interfacial processes according to the following sections: (i) preparation of assembled structures and conversion into nanostructured materials, (ii) dynamic structural transformation to hierarchic materials, and (iii) material preparation and functions with dynamic flows at interfacial media. Not limited to the material production, dynamic processes at the interface can be also connected with forefront functions such as tuning of molecular receptors and mechanical controls. This perspective article can conclude that fabrication of functional materials and controls of nanosystems would be well-considered on the basis of these three key terms.
